Prime Minister's Office Prime Minister extends greetings to the people of Gujarat on Gujarat Day Posted On: 01 MAY 2026 9:14AM by PIB Delhi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i today extended his warm greetings to the people of Gujarat on the special occasion of Gujarat Day. The Prime Minister posted on X: "Warm greetings to the people of Gujarat on the special occasion of Gujarat Day. This day is a celebration of the rich history, vibrant culture and remarkable spirit of Gujarat. The state has made an outstanding contribution to India's progress. The dynamic and enterprising nature of the people is noteworthy. May Gujarat continue scaling new heights of progress in the coming times.” Warm greetings to the people of Gujarat on the special occasion of Gujarat Day.
